====== Выгрузка данных в JoomShopping и таблицы БД в JoomShopping ======
Описание полей и общих принципов выгрузки: http://1c77-1c8x.ru/external-component-1-c/exchange-with-mysql.html
===== Производители (jos_jshopping_manufacturers) =====
Код manufacturer_id
Наименование рус. name_ru-RU
Наименование eng. name_en-GB
===== Группы номенклатуры (jos_jshopping_categories) =====
Код category_id
Наименование category_name
Дата создания cdate
Дата выгрузки mdate
Дата выгрузки list_order
flypage category_flypage
Количество номенклатуры в ряду products_row
Признак публикации category_publish
===== Элементы номенклатуры (jos_jshopping_products) =====
Код product_id
Артикул product_ean
Наименование name_ru-RU
Наименование name_en-GB
Описание (краткое) short_description_ru-RU
Описание (подробное) description_ru-RU
Картинка (уменьшенная) product_thumb_image
Картинка (оригинал) product_full_image
Картинка product_name_image
Статус публикации product_publish
Вес product_weight
Остаток product_quantity
Старая цена product_old_price
Цена закупки product_buy_price
Цена product_price
Производитель product_manufacturer_id
Дата выгрузки date_modify
jos_jshopping_products_to_categories
Код product_id
Группа category_id
===== Загрузка заказов =====
Данные
Покупатели
Идентификатор
Компания
Фамилия
Имя
Телефон
Мобильный телефон
Email
Индекс
Область
Город
Адрес
Заказы
Номер заказа
Дата заказа
Адрес доставки
Покупатель
Комментарий
Номенклатура
Характеристика
Количество
===== Назначение таблиц =====
==== JoomShopping 4.2.2 ====
Через дробь указаны пункты меню
**Значения по умолчанию указываются в файле /components/com_jshopping/lib/default_config.php**
jshopping_addons - описание дополнений
jshopping_attr - Опции / Атрибуты
jshopping_attr_values - Сами значения атрибутов
jshopping_cart_temp - Список пожеланий (Отложить)
jshopping_categories - Настройки / Категория/Товар
jshopping_config - Настройки JoomShopping
jshopping_config_display_prices - ?
jshopping_config_seo - Настройки / SEO
jshopping_config_statictext - Настройки / Статический текст
jshopping_countries - Опции / Список стран
jshopping_coupons - Опции / Купоны
jshopping_currencies - Настройки / Валюта
jshopping_delivery_times - Опции / Сроки поставки
jshopping_free_attr - Опции / Свободные атрибуты
jshopping_import_export - Опции / Импорт и экспорт
jshopping_languages - Опции / Языки
jshopping_manufacturers - Опции / Производители
jshopping_orders - Заказы
jshopping_order_history - История заказов
jshopping_order_item - Товары в заказах
jshopping_order_status - Статусы заказов
jshopping_payment_method - Опции / Способ оплаты
jshopping_products - Товары
jshopping_products_attr - Атрибуты для каждого из товаров: кол-во, цена, вес и т.д.
jshopping_products_attr2 - Изменение цены для определенных атрибутов товаров
jshopping_products_extra_fields - Опции / Характеристики товаров
jshopping_products_extra_field_groups - Опции / Характеристики товаров (группы)
jshopping_products_extra_field_values - Опции / Характеристики товаров (значения)
jshopping_products_files - Файлы товаров
jshopping_products_free_attr - Связь товаров и свободных атрибутов
jshopping_products_images - Изображения товаров
jshopping_products_prices - Цены товаров
jshopping_products_relations - Связанные товары
jshopping_products_reviews - Опции / Отзывы о товарах
jshopping_products_to_categories - Связь товаров и категорий
jshopping_products_videos - Видео для товаров
jshopping_product_labels - Опции / Метки товаров
jshopping_shipping_ext_calc - Опции / Способ доставки / Цены способов доставки
jshopping_shipping_method - Опции / Способ доставки
jshopping_shipping_method_price - Опции / Цены на доставку
jshopping_shipping_method_price_countries - Опции / Цены на доставку (привязка по странам)
jshopping_shipping_method_price_weight - Опции / Цены на доставку (привязка по весу товаров)
jshopping_taxes - Опции / Налоги
jshopping_taxes_ext - Опции / Налоги / Расширенные налоговые правила
jshopping_unit - Единицы измерения
jshopping_usergroups - Опции / Группы пользователей
jshopping_users - Клиенты
jshopping_vendors - Настройки / Информация о магазине
**Производители таблица - manufacturers**
Код manufacturer_id
Наименование name_ru-RU
Логотип manufacturer_logo
URL manufacturer_url
Описание (Краткое) short_description_ru-RU
Описание (Подробное) description_ru-RU
METATitle meta_title_ru-RU
METADescription meta_description_ru-RU
METAKeywords meta_keyword_ru-RU
**Группы номенклатуры таблица - categories**
Код category_id
Группа category_parent_id
Наименование name_ru-RU
Описание (Краткое) short_description_ru-RU
Описание (Подробное) description_ru-RU
Картинка category_image
METATitle meta_title_ru-RU
META Description meta_description_ru-RU
META Keywords meta_keyword_ru-RU
Дата создания category_add_date
**Элементы номенклатуры таблица - products**
Код product_id
Артикул product_ean
Наименование name_ru-RU
Описание (Краткое) short_description_ru-RU
Описание (Подробное) description_ru-RU
Фотография (В списке) product_thumb_image
Фотография (В описании) product_name_image
Фотография (Увеличенная) product_full_image
Производитель product_manufacturer_id
Цена product_price
Остаток product_quantity
Статус product_publish
Вес product_weight
Дата создания product_date_added
Дата выгрузки date_modify
METATitle meta_title_ru-RU
METADescription meta_description_ru-RU
METAKeywords meta_keyword_ru-RU
products_to_categories
Код product_id
Группа category_id
**Дополнительные фотографии таблица - products_images**
Код фотографии image_id
Код товара product_id
Наименование name
Фотография (В списке) image_thumb
Фотография (В описании) image_name
Фотография (Дополнительная) image_full
Номер картинки ordering
**Рекомендуемые товары таблица - products_relations**
Код товара product_id
Рекомендуемые товары product_related_id
**Статусы заказов таблица - orders**
Номер order_id
Статус order_status
order_history
Номер order_id
Статус order_status_id
Дата статуса status_date_added
===== Пути к файлам =====
components/com_jshopping/files/files_products - файлы товаров
components/com_jshopping/files/img_attributes - изображения атрибутов товаров
components/com_jshopping/files/img_categories - изображения категорий товаров
components/com_jshopping/files/img_labels - изображения меток товаров
components/com_jshopping/files/img_manufs - изображения производителей
components/com_jshopping/files/img_products/ - изображения товаров
components/com_jshopping/files/img_vendors - изображения продавцов
components/com_jshopping/files/importexport - ?
components/com_jshopping/files/pdf_orders - pdf-файлы заказов
components/com_jshopping/files/video_products - видео для товаров
===== Таблицы БД в JoomShopping =====
==== Universal CSV Import. Example and type field. ====
Field: id - Product ID
Type: integer
Example: 320
Field: ean - Product Code
Type: string
Example: A0000123
Field: quantity - product quantity
Type: integer, ("+" - unlimited)
Example: 120
Field: add_date
Type: date (default: Y-m-d H:i:s). You can configure
Example: 2010-10-10 23:50:51
Field: modyfy_date
Type: date (default: Y-m-d H:i:s). You can configure
Example: 2010-10-10 23:50:51
Field: published
Type: integer (1,0)
Example: 1
Field: tax_name
Type: stirng
Example: Normal
Field: tax_value
Type: float
Example: 19
Field: url - Detail description product
Type: string
Example: http://www.test.com/
Field: old_price
Type: float
Example: 120.25
Field: purchase_price
Type: float
Example: 320.23
Field: price
Type: float
Example: 100.05
Field: weight
Type: float
Example: 25.00
Field: average_rating
Type: float
Example: 7.50
Field: reviews_count
Type: integer
Example: 20
Field: hits
Type: integer
Example: 320
Field: unit_of_measurement_count
Type: float
Example: 2.50
Field: label
Type: string
Example: New
Field: images - list images
Type: string(Name, Url)
Example Name: test.jpg|test2.jpg|test3.jpg
Need upload 3 file in ftp folder /components/com_jshopping/files/img_products
Example Url: http://www.test.com/test.jpg|http://www.test.com/test2.jpg
Field: videos
Type: string(Name, Url)
Example Name: test.avi|test2.avi|test3.avi
Need upload 3 file in ftp folder /components/com_jshopping/files/video_products
Example Url: http://www.test.com/test.avi|http://www.test.com/test2.avi
Field: sale_files
Type: string(Name, Url)
Example Name: test.avi|test2.avi|test3.avi
Need upload 3 file in ftp folder /components/com_jshopping/files/files_products
Example Url: http://www.test.com/test.avi|http://www.test.com/test2.avi
Field: demo_files
Type: string(Name, Url)
Example Name: test.avi|test2.avi|test3.avi
Need upload 3 file in ftp folder /components/com_jshopping/files/demo_products
Example Url: http://www.test.com/test.avi|http://www.test.com/test2.avi
Field: manufacturer
Type: string
Example: Sony
Field: delivery_time
Type: string
Example: 3 day
Field: units_of_measurement
Type: string
Example: Liter
Field: name
Type: string
Example: product name
Field: alias
Type: string
Example: product-name
Field: short_description
Type: string
Example: test test test
Field: description
Type: string
Example: big description
Field: meta_title
Type: string
Example: title product
Field: meta_description
Type: string
Example: description for google
Field: meta_keyword
Type: string
Example: keyword for search
Field: category
Type: string (category/subcategory|category2....)
Example: category/subcategory|cat1/subcat1
Descr.: product in 2 category
Field: vendor
Type: string
Example: email@email
Descr.: Email vendor. The vendor must already exist.
Field: price_per_consignment - Price per consignment
Type: string (from:to:price|from2:to2:price2|...)
Example: 1:10:120|11:100:115|101:1000:105
Field: related_produts - list id related product
Type: string (id|id2|id3...)
Example: 5|6|7
Field: characteristics - list charactiristcs
Type: string (name:value|name2:value2...)
Example: Power:100|Doors:4
Field: freeattributes - list Free attribute
Type: string (name|name2...)
Example: Label
Field: attributes - list attribute
Type: string
Example (attribute Dependent): color:Red/size:M/price:121/count:12/ean:Ab12342/old_price:150/weight:20|color:Red/size:S/price:122/count:12/ean:Ab12342/old_price:150/weight:20
Descr.: 2 Dependent attribute
Example (attribute Independent): color:Red/pricemod:+/price:2|color:Blue/pricemod:-/price:1|size:xl/pricemod:-/price:1
Descr.: 2 Independent attribute
Field: price_for_group - Price for user group (Need install Addon "Product price for User Group")
Type: string (group:price|group2:price2...)
Example: Silver:125|Gold:121
Field: shippings - Shipping for product (Need install addon "Shipping product")
Type: string (SH_PR_ID:price:publish|SH_PR_ID:price:publish...)
SH_PR_ID - shipping price id (see ../administrator/index.php?option=com_jshopping&controller=shippingsprices)
price: float or -1. (-1 - use default price shipping)
publish: (1,0)
Example: 1:12.5:1|2:10:0
{{tag>joomla joomshopping выгрузка 1С назначение_таблиц tables DB таблицы БД пути}}